Reduce gpsd log verbosity a lot.
Way too much logging was happening at LOG_IO level, which is intended for watching data traffic in and out of the daemon rather than all the minutiae of data analysis - that's LOG_DATA. Also, LOG_DATA gets pushed down two levels. The effect is that -D 5 means exactly what it did, but for purposes other than driver debugging -D 4 now suffices.
